Cox Automotive Strategy Chief Amy Mills to Retire After 25 Years - Cox Automotive Inc.
Amy Mills, executive vice president and chief strategy officer at Cox Automotive, announced her retirement after 25 years with the company. This is a significant C-suite departure from a major automotive dealership technology vendor.
